Sažetak
The press release, or the media release, has hardly changed format since its invention by Ivy Ledbetter Lee in 1906. The purpose of this paper is to explore how the increasing importance of social media and the gradual decline of traditional media affect practices and predictions in Croatian public relations practitioners relating to the media release as a public relations tool. Structured interviews were conducted with five Croatian public relations practitioners of differing backgrounds and experiences. The authors begin the research hypothesizing that public relations practitioners hold opinions indicating that the media release will have to change in the future due to the changing nature and format of the media. After analysing the interviews, it was concluded that the media release is here to stay as an indispensable tool for public relations, but is likely to change to a multimedia format or in other, unpredictable, ways due to technology change.
